John Pacheco, CRNA Obituary

PACHECO, CRNA, John J., 71, formerly of St. Petersburg, Florida, passed away, Saturday evening, September 3, 2022 at the HopeHealth Hulitar Hospice Center, Providence.

Born in Providence, a son of the late Christina L. (Pimental) Pacheco and John Pacheco.

John grew up on Clyde Street in West Warwick as a child and then on Knight Street and attended the former St. Anthony’s School graduating in 1965.  He graduated from West Warwick High School in 1969 and graduated from RI School of Practical Nursing in 1972, received an A.A. from Rhode Island Junior College in 1973 initially started there in 1969.  He continued his nursing studies in 1974 at Salve Regina University, graduating with a Bachelor of Science in Nursing with a minor in biology in 1976. From 1972 thru 1982, he worked as a LPN/RN at the former RI Medical Center General Hospital, LP Building and in 1979 transferred over to the IMH and worked as a psych nurse in adult and adolescent units.  While still working nights there, he started nurse anesthesia training at St. Joseph’s Hospital in 1981, graduating in 1983 from the two year diploma program.  He worked at St. Joseph’s and Fatima Hospitals as a Nurse Anesthetist for many years and in 1989 he received his Master of Science degree for Rhode Island College.  He also worked in the emergency room at Kent Hospital and taught at CCRI, Warwick Campus in the Biology department from 1990-2000 as adjunct instructor.  In 2000 he moved to Fort Pierce, Florida as nursing director in the emergency room for one year and moved to St. Petersburg, Florida where he lived for twenty years and worked as nursing supervisor at Kindred Hospital, Bay Area until 2008.  From 2005-2015 he also was adjunct instructor at Hillsborough Community College in Tampa teaching medical courses and anatomy in the Medical Coding department.  Toward the end of his nursing career he was Case Manager at Bayfront Medical Center and in 2008through 2021 he was an appeals nurse reviewer for Wellcare/Centene Insurance Company in Tampa.  He was an organist at several churches in Rhode Island and loved the beaches and beautiful places in St. Petersburg.  He returned home to Rhode Island a month ago.

He is survived by his sister, Carolyn L. Pacheco and her spouse Suzette; his partner of ten years, Michael Elliott of Tampa, FL; two uncles, Antonio Pimental and Thomas Pimental and many cousins in Rhode Island and the Azores and valued colleagues throughout the years.
